Show me where this "void", between spine and lungs, is in the picture below....

[Linked Image]

As Shaw said, the spine dips a LOT lower than most folks realize....there is no "void" between the spine and lungs to speak of, as you can see from the picture posted. I also saw a picture of a deer someone killed on Archery Talk a couple of years ago, though I can't find the thread now, where the guy's broadhead hit both the spine AND the top of the lungs. You CANNOT put an arrow in a [anatomically healthy] deer that goes between the spine and lungs without hitting one or the other (or both).
